CHARLOTTE, NC – Setting a school record for Hutchinson Community College and running a time not seen by a Blue Dragon runner in 40 years, Faith Jepchirchir has earned her second NJCAA Division 1 Women’s Cross Country Runner of the Week award during the 2024 season by bringing home week 6 honors.
Faith Jepchirchir – Hutchinson (NJCAA Division 1 Women’s Cross Country Runner of the Week)
After 40 years of no sub-18-minute times, Blue Dragon freshman Faith Jepchirchir obliterated the Hutchinson women's cross country record at 5,000 meters with a time of 17:08.1 at the Arkansas Chili Pepper Festival in Fayetteville, AR. Jepchirchir placed 21st in the Chili Pepper, shattering the old Blue Dragon 5K record by 1 minute and 4 seconds. She was one of three Blue Dragon runners to run sub-18 minutes on Saturday. Jepchirchir has one event win this season.
